There is a lot of activity on the CSST horizon, including the What on Earth Colloquium, hosted by New Zealand Space Agency and in partnership with Venture Southland, Landcare, LINZ and CSST. The colloquium will bring together the following individuals and organisations to help shape the future of the space sector in New Zealand:
Industry users of land information, including agriculture, forestry, power generation, infrastructure and resource management, particularly business development, R&D and strategic managers
Space industry organisations with a focus on satellite and earth observation data
Policy makers and agencies with responsibility for environmental management, climate change, primary industries, civil infrastructure, disaster management, defence and related portfolios
Research and technical specialists
Big data and machine learning specialists
